Vauxhall Nova — MOT Reliability Overview

The Vauxhall Nova has an average MOT pass rate of 84.2%, which is 2.2 percentage points above the Vauxhall brand average of 82.0%. This is a strong result, indicating that the Nova is well-engineered and tends to age well mechanically. Owners can expect fewer surprises at MOT time.

The most common reasons a Vauxhall Nova fails its MOT are a lamp missing, inoperative or in the case of a multiple light source more than 1/2 not functioning, the strength or continuity of the load bearing structure within 30cm of any sub-frame, spring or suspension component mounting (a 'prescribed area') is significantly reduced or inadequately repaired, the aim of a headlamp is not within limits laid down in the requirements. Top MOT Failures — Vauxhall Nova

The most common reasons a Vauxhall Nova fails its MOT, aggregated across all year ranges.

1

A lamp missing, inoperative or in the case of a multiple light source more than 1/2 not functioning

8.3%
2

The strength or continuity of the load bearing structure within 30cm of any sub-frame, spring or suspension component mounting (a 'prescribed area') is significantly reduced or inadequately repaired

3.3%
3

The aim of a headlamp is not within limits laid down in the requirements

2.9%
4

Emissions levels exceed default limits

2.9%
5

A transmission shaft constant velocity joint boot missing or no longer prevents the ingress of dirt etc

2.0%
